Employee Is Killed After Foundation Wall Collapses

At 12:00 p.m. on April 6, 2015, an employee was working as part of a work crew at the foundation of a building being renovated. The employee was struck by foundation dirt and partially buried while assisting in an underpinning operation. The initial report does not indicate how the employee was struck by the dirt nor the injuries sustained. The employee was killed.
